كيفية تثبيت شهادة التشفير اس اس ال في لايت باد

تثبيت شهادة التشفير في لايت باد

في المشهد الرقمي اليوم، أصبح تأمين موقع الويب الخاص بك باستخدام تشفير SSL/TLS أمرًا ضروريًا. Let’s Encrypt, سلطة شهادة مجانية ومفتوحة، توفر طريقة سهلة وآلية للحصول على شهادات SSL وتركيبها. في هذه المقالة، سنرشدك خلال عملية التثبيت شهادة Let’ s Encrypt في Lighttpd، خادم ويب خفيف الوزن وفعال.

متطلبات

قبل أن نبدأ، تأكد من وجود الشروط الأساسية التالية:

  1. مثال تشغيل Lighttpd على الخادم الخاص بك.
  2. اسم النطاق المرتبط بعنوان IP الخاص بالخادم.
  3. الوصول إلى Shell أو بيانات اعتماد SSH إلى الخادم الخاص بك.

الآن، دعونا نغوص في الخطوات المطلوبة لتثبيت شهادة Let’ s Encrypt في Lighttpd:

الخطوة 1: تثبيت Certbot

Certbot هي أداة سطر أمر توفرها Let’ s Encrypt للحصول على شهادات SSL وإدارتها. نحن بحاجة إلى تثبيت Certbot على الخادم لدينا.

يمكنك اتباع هذا البرنامج التعليمي حول كيف إعداد إس إس إل (SSL) Let’s Encrypt على أوبونتو.

الخطوة 2: الحصول على شهادة SSL

الآن بعد أن قمنا بتثبيت Certbot، يمكننا المضي قدمًا في الحصول على شهادة SSL لمجالك.

  • أوقف خدمة Lighttpd:
$ sudo systemctl stop lighttpd
  • تشغيل الأمر التالي للحصول على الشهادة:
$ sudo certbot certonly --standalone -d your-domain.com

تعويض your-domain.com مع اسم المجال الفعلي الخاص بك. تأكد من تنفيذ الأمر بنجاح، وإنشاء ملفات الشهادة.

  • ابدأ خدمة Lighttpd:
$ sudo systemctl start lighttpd

الخطوة 3: ضبط Lighttpd لـ SSL

مع وجود شهادة SSL، نحتاج إلى تكوين Lighttpd لاستخدام الشهادة للاتصالات الآمنة.

  • افتح ملف تكوين Lighttpd:
$ sudo nano /etc/lighttpd/lighttpd.conf
  • أضف السطور التالية إلى ملف التهيئة:
$SERVER["socket"] == ":443" {
    ssl.engine = "enable"
    ssl.pemfile = "/etc/letsencrypt/live/your-domain.com/fullchain.pem"
    ssl.privkey = "/etc/letsencrypt/live/your-domain.com/privkey.pem"
}

تعويض your-domain.com مع اسم المجال الفعلي الخاص بك.

  • حفظ وخروج الملف.
  • إعادة تشغيل خدمة Lighttpd حتى تدخل التغييرات حيز التنفيذ:
$ sudo systemctl restart lighttpd

الخطوة 4: أتمتة تجديد الشهادة

دعونا نشفر شهادات SSL لها فترة صلاحية 90 يومًا. لضمان حماية SSL دون انقطاع، يجب علينا أتمتة عملية تجديد الشهادة.

  • قم بفتح crontab للتعديل
$ sudo crontab -e
  • يضاف السطر التالي في نهاية الملف:
0 0 * * * certbot renew --quiet

هذا يوجه النظام لتجديد الشهادات تلقائيًا يوميًا في منتصف الليل.

  • حفظ وخروج الملف.

الخطوة 5: اختبار تكوين SSL

الآن بعد أن تم إعداد كل شيء، حان الوقت لاختبار تكوين SSL.

  • افتح متصفح الويب الخاص بك وأدخل اسم النطاق الخاص بك مع https:// البادئة (على سبيل المثال،  https://your-domain.com).
  • إذا كان تثبيت SSL ناجحًا، فيجب أن ترى أيقونة قفل أو إشارة مماثلة لاتصال آمن في شريط عناوين المستعرض.

تهانينا! لقد نجحت في تثبيت شهادة Let’ s Encrypt SSL في Lighttpd. موقع الويب الخاص بك مؤمن الآن مع الاتصالات المشفرة.

خلاصة

يعد تأمين موقع الويب الخاص بك باستخدام تشفير SSL/TLS أمرًا بالغ الأهمية لحماية البيانات الحساسة واكتساب ثقة المستخدم. دعونا نشفر تبسيط العملية من خلال توفير شهادات SSL مجانية وآلية. من خلال اتباع الخطوات الموضحة في هذه المقالة، يمكنك بسهولة تثبيت شهادة Let’ s Encrypt في Lighttpd وتعزيز أمان موقع الويب الخاص بك. استمتع بفوائد تجربة تصفح آمنة ومشفرة!

LEAVE A COMMENT